2001 Vauxhall Zafira power loss and hesitating

Car: Vauxhall Zafira
Year: 2001
Variant: 1.8 16v automatic
Categories: Running Rough, Starting & Power Loss
I have recently had a problem with my car hesitating when pressing accelerator and a losing power too.

I have had a replacement exhaust - whole thing!!
lamber censor!!
Coil pack
plugs
clean of the pipe work leading to engine
and its still doing it.
There are no codes and my car doesn't have and EGR valve, the car also starts first time and purrs!!
please help
